Community Development: Petrocam Responds to Appeal; Repairs Damaged Portion of Road

    Following The Alimosho Mail’s report on the damaged portion of Federal Site Road subsequent to the complaints of residents and members of Gloryland CDA in Egbe Idimu LCDA, the management of Petrocam filling station has graciously filled up the damaged portion thereby providing succour to them. Members of the community can now heave a sigh of relief.

    In the report, the community had complained about the neglect of the damaged portion of the road by the management of Petrocam filling station which is directly on its entrance and had also complained of how their efforts to get him fix the road had proved abortive. They said their several efforts in fixing the road were futile as a result of the parking of articulated vehicles on the failed portion of the road.

    The community has expressed their gratitude to The Alimosho Mail and thanked Petrocam for responding to their complaints.

    We wish to reiterate that The Alimosho Mail newspaper is an independent media outfit and cannot be used in any way to witch hunt anyone. We also use this medium to thank the management of Petrocam filling station for their kind gesture.
